Exemplary Bodies: Constructing the Jew in Russian Culture, 1880s to 2008 - Borderlines: Russian and East European-Jewish Studies
Henrietta Mondry
Explores the construction of the Jew's physical and ontological body in Russian culture as represented in literature, film, and non-literary texts since the 1880s.
